Need to finish painting the taco without a paint booth. Message me if you have any tips on best way to do this
2 beach umbrellas for shade and temp control. Wet the floor in order for dust/debris to not kick up. Mask all areas not intended for paint. If possible, try to control crosswinds from altering spray patterns so you need to get creative on that one(painting next to a building/wall helps a lot). Taking the time to prep is key!
